  • Close the network card?

    I have a machine that I have leveled off for XP Pro SP3 because I have a few HW record that ONLY works on XP.

    I want comtrol machine including = WOL WakeOnLAN remotely.

    I had an old IBM Thinkcenter used for recording HW, but I want a bit more powerful machine of Noah - let's call it MC.

    The MC has been running Windows 7 before but now ranked out of XP Pro SP3 and it works fine - with the exception of WOL installation.

    I simply does not work and I see that the network adapter is SHUT OFF when the machine is turned off - the old IBM ThinkCenter I can always see the LED light when it is turned off.

    I beleave there are new drivers for the network card, but I checked the settings on the parameters WOL and I did also the settings in the BIOS.

    Still no light in the LED on the back of the RJ45 of computers. Also I see no light on the swichport where the MC cable is inserted into the switch.

    It is on the Ethernet card on board and it is a NVIDIA nForce 10/100/1000 Mbps Ethernet with "drivers".

    What can be wrong here and how I can fix the problem?

    You may have read my first post that I deleted later because I had completely misread your post before responding.  As I said then, Wake on Lan is controlled by the motherboard and firmware of the NETWORK adapter, it is not dependent on the operating system, a compatible computer without any OS installed WOL can be started by WOL providing that it is properly enabled in the BIOS and NETWORK card firmware.   Windows (or other operating system) really has nothing as such to do with function Wake on Lan, the extent to which any OS with WOL is limited because it can enable the feature in the firmware of the NETWORK adapter through the drivers or other utilities provided by the manufacturer of the device.  If it worked before then you know that the computer is able to do, was not because Windows 7 has been installed, it worked because it has been correctly configured in the firmware of the NETWORK adapter and the BIOS.  When you installed Windows XP it is most likely did not have the drivers for the NETWORK card and it may have reset the NIC to default settings that cannot be reset correctly with the drivers you have installed later.  Have you installed the card mother/chipset drivers?  They may be needed for other drivers work correctly.

    Wake on Lan has everything to do with the BIOS, it is implemented by the motherboard.  If your computer is capable of WOL (which we know that it is) there is an option for it in the BIOS, it might be under a different name, like "Power Up on PCI device" or something else.  If you don't see a power management Option in the BIOS, it might be in the advanced settings, it's there somewhere.  If Windows can have changed WOL BIOS settings during installation is something that I don't know, but I can tell you that Windows can change some settings in the BIOS, you can adjust the timers BIOS to start the computer at scheduled time so who knows what he might be able to change.

    Before going to the road Time Machine... (which I do not know the answer anyway)

    Try this:

    With the logic does not--

    Remove the 10 logic preferences file AND the areas of shared control file.

    (In your case, simply remove the control surfaces pref)

    In the Finder, choose go > go to folder from the menu.

    Type ~/Library/Preferences in the field 'go to folder '. (Note :) Type exactly-> ~/Library/Preferences)

    Press the Go button.

    Delete the file com.apple.logic10.plist from the Preferences folder. Note that if you set custom shortcuts, it will reset to the default values. You can export your custom key as a preset before performing this step. See the user manual Pro Logic for more details on how to do it. If you are having problems with a with Logic Pro control surface.

    then delete the file com.apple.logic.pro.cs from the Preferences folder.

    Next time you start logic will be rebuilt the default surface control file.
